Mesothelioma

Mesothelioma is a kind of cancer that affects the thin layer of tissue that covers organs in the body. It is usually caused by exposure to asbestos which is a substance that is utilized in a variety of industrial applications. Asbestos victims may be entitled to compensation from the companies who exposed them to this dangerous substance. A Chicago mesothelioma lawyer can help victims get the compensation they deserve.

Mesothelioma usually occurs in the layers of tissue that cover the lung (the pleura). It can also begin in the peritoneum - which is the thick membrane that surrounds the organs of the stomach. Mesothelioma symptoms include stomach or chest pain, breathing problems or coughing, fever, and a cough. The disease is usually diagnosed by a doctor who runs a physical exam and takes down a victim's medical history. A doctor may order a CT scan or chest X-ray to look for mesothelioma signs such as lung inflammation scarring, pleural plaques, and pleural plaques.

Asbestos exposure in military bases

For decades asbestos has been used in all branches of the military because it is strong, fireproof and a great insulation. Asbestos is used extensively to build housing on bases aircrafts, ships, and ships. When it was disturbed during renovation or installation work asbestos particles were released into the air and people breathed in these toxic fibers. Veterans from all branches of the military are at risk of asbestos exposure, which can lead to diseases like mesothelioma and lung cancer.

There were still plenty of chances for soldiers to be exposed to asbestos even though Army bases do to be less asbestos-rich as Navy and Air Force bases. Asbestos was in the cement flooring, roofing materials and flooring of buildings on Army bases. Asbestos was also found in bedding as well as in the insulation of ceilings, walls, and brakes, clutch plates and gaskets for vehicles. Infantrymen of the Army were particularly at risk for exposure as they were often employed in motor pools, repairing and maintaining transport vehicles of all types.

It is also known that members of the Merchant Marine transported cargo and passengers in peacetime as well as during the war. Asbestos was a problem on their vessels in boiler rooms pipes, steam lines heaters, valves, heaters and gaskets. Workers working in the Merchant Marine were exposed when they dismantled or repaired vehicles that belonged to the armed forces.

All three branches of the military have used asbestos from the 1930s until the 1970s. The Navy, Air Force, and Army all used asbestos on their bases, as well as in their ships and planes.
